Chmura Economics & Analytics

New

Marketing Manager

The Marketing Manager is responsible for developing and executing Chmura’s marketing initiatives across its SaaS and Consulting business lines. This hands-on role combines go-to-market planning, campaign execution, content development, digital marketing, and marketing operations.

The Marketing Manager will assess market opportunities, customer needs, and competitive positioning to develop effective go-to-market approaches and translate those strategies into marketing campaigns and initiatives.

Key Responsibilities

Go-to-Market Strategy & Positioning (25%)

  • Assess market opportunities, customer needs, and competitive positioning to develop go-to-market approaches for Chmura’s products and services.
  • Define target audiences, value propositions, messaging, channels, and marketing tactics.
  • Develop go-to-market plans in partnership with Product, Sales, Consulting, and other stakeholders.
  • Evaluate results and market feedback to refine positioning and go-to-market approaches.

Campaign Execution & Demand Generation (25%)

  • Develop, execute, and optimize integrated marketing campaigns that support lead generation, customer engagement, and company growth.
  • Manage digital marketing activities across email, PPC and other paid media, website, SEO, and other relevant channels.
  • Manage marketing automation activities, including campaigns, audience segmentation, and automated customer journeys.
  • Monitor campaign performance and adjust tactics based on engagement, conversion, and lead-generation results.

Content, Brand & Sales Enablement (20%)

  • Develop and coordinate marketing content and customer-facing materials across channels.
  • Partner with Sales to develop presentations, case studies, collateral, and other sales enablement resources.
  • Translate technical, economic, data, and product information into clear, compelling customer-facing messaging.
  • Maintain consistent brand positioning and messaging across marketing channels.

Agency & Marketing Operations (20%)

  • Manage Chmura’s external marketing agency partner, including priorities, project briefs, deliverables, timelines, and results.
  • Maintain the marketing calendar and coordinate campaigns, product launches, events, and other marketing activities.
  • Manage marketing activities, vendors, and agency expenses within the established budget.
  • Identify opportunities to improve marketing processes, tools, and workflows.

Market Insights & Performance (10%)

  • Conduct customer, competitor, and market research to inform positioning and marketing strategy.
  • Track and report on key marketing metrics and recommend changes to improve marketing effectiveness.
  • Coordinate Chmura’s participation in conferences, webinars, and other external marketing opportunities.
